Abstract

The invention discloses a kind of battery lodge bodies peculiar to vessel, the lower box and case lid being connected as one including movable make-up, it is characterized in that, the bottom surface of the lower box is swelled into case forms rectangular radiating part, rectangular fin that is parallel and waiting gap distributions is uniformly provided in the one side of radiating part upward, rectangular fin is vertical with the one side of radiating part upward, the radiating part and fin are the interlayer cavity of interior sky, the interlayer cavity of each fin with the interlayer cavity unicom of radiating part, the closed cavity being formed as one, the inner wall of closed cavity is covered with the liquid-sucking core made of fibrous material, and phase-change heat medium is equipped in closed cavity, fixed placement single battery battery core between two pieces of fins of arbitrary neighborhood.This lodge body is simple in structure, at low cost, good heat dissipation effect.

Technical field
The present invention relates to the nonactive component technologies of battery pack, and in particular to the babinet of packaging electric core is used in battery pack, Especially a kind of battery lodge body peculiar to vessel.
Background technology
Energy conservation and environmental protection theory is advocated energetically recently as country, and lithium ion battery is wide as a kind of high-efficiency cleaning energy It is general to be applied to various occasions.
It usually requires to be formed several single battery cores according to actual demand when with lithium ion battery to power supply for electrical equipment Battery pack, battery pack generally comprise battery core module, BMS control modules and the babinet for accommodating battery core module and BMS control modules. In order to ensure battery core module, BMS control the safety of module, it is used for the body structure of packaging electric core module and BMS control modules Intensity is very high, to achieve the purpose that reinforce degree of protection.
Since the leakproofness and Structural strength calls of battery pack are relatively high, this causes the heat dissipation performance of battery pack poor, The heat that battery core module generates in babinet can not be successfully discharge babinet, be increased so as to cause case body temperature, and then give battery pack Bring security risk.Electric ship development is quick, however, since ship indoor environment is moist, sultry and poor air permeability, this causes to pacify Battery pack loaded on cabin energy is more difficult to radiate, and there are great security risks.
Invention content
The purpose of the present invention is in view of the deficiencies of the prior art, and provide a kind of battery lodge body peculiar to vessel.This lodge body Simple in structure, at low cost, good heat dissipation effect.
Realizing the technical solution of the object of the invention is:
A kind of battery lodge body peculiar to vessel, including lower box and case lid that movable make-up is connected as one, the bottom of the lower box Rectangular radiating part is formed towards protuberance in case, is uniformly provided with parallel in the one side of radiating part upward and waits gap distributions Rectangular fin, rectangular fin is vertical with the one side of radiating part upward, and the radiating part and fin are the interlayer cavity of interior sky, often The interlayer cavity of one fin is with the interlayer cavity unicom of radiating part, the closed cavity being formed as one, the inner wall of closed cavity It is covered in liquid-sucking core and closed cavity made of fibrous material and is equipped with phase-change heat medium, two pieces of fins of arbitrary neighborhood Between fixed placement single battery battery core.
Fixation clip is installed above the fin.
The quantity of the fin is at least five.
Gap in said program between two pieces of fins of arbitrary neighborhood constitutes the space of the fixed single battery core of installation, composition After battery pack, tank floor is close to the installation of cabin bottom surface and is fixed, it is more abundant to make tank floor contact with cabin bottom surface, Can be in the materials such as the underfill silicone grease of lower box, work, phase-change heat medium is uniform under the capillary force effect of liquid-sucking core Spread to fin side wall, the heat that subsequent battery core generates makes the gasification of phase-change heat medium take away amount of heat, the phase after gasification Become heat eliminating medium to spread to radiating part, since bottom and the cabin bottom surface of babinet come into full contact with, and cabin bottom is immersed in always The water surface is hereinafter, can quickly distribute heat, to make gaseous phase-change heat medium liquefaction release heat.
This lodge body is simple in structure, at low cost, good heat dissipation effect.
